Output de2081b85f550aba72db8d01d2a9aaada6f49ccd7e3cd63ba01e96a2fee9fd2d:0

value
43752928
script pubkey
OP_0 OP_PUSHBYTES_20 56bbb61b5402643ad758ee84bed04cf3cf6095dd
address
bc1q26amvx65qfjr446ca6zta5zv708kp9wa7g05e6
transaction
de2081b85f550aba72db8d01d2a9aaada6f49ccd7e3cd63ba01e96a2fee9fd2d
confirmations
195959
spent
true